2 Naga women to receive Nari Shakti Awards

Two Naga women namely Zuboni Humtsoe and Bano Haralu have been chosen from Nagaland as awardees of Nari Shakti Awards on International Women’s Day to be presented by the President of India, Pranab Mukherjee on March 8 at 12 p.m. at Rashtrapati Bhawan.
Ministry of Women and Child Development, Government of India would be honouring contribution to women’s empowerment, with the presentation of Nari Shakti Awards on International Women’s Day. 
It must be noted that Zuboni Humtsoe started Preciousmelove (PML) in 2011 and also started ‘Nungshiba’ Handicrafts division of PML which recycles waste fabrics from textile manufacturing units to make beautiful handmade dolls of Northeast India. PML launched its own e-commerce website, becoming the first fashion e-commerce site from Northeast India run by an all-girls team. 
 Bano Haralu has two decades of work experience with both state and private broadcast media, namely Doordarshan and New Delhi Television. 
She has set up the Nagaland Wildlife and Biodiversity Conservation Trust and coordinated various surveys to determine the status of wildlife in the state for the Forest Department. 
The Nari Shakti Puraskar was instituted in 1999 and awards are conferred on individuals and institutions in recognition of their service to the cause of women.
